As the popularity of ridesharing services like Uber continues to soar, so does the need to tackle the alarming issue of assault and violence faced by drivers and passengers alike. While these platforms have revolutionized the way we travel and provided convenience, they have also unintentionally created potential for offenders. This article seeks to shed light on the challenges associated with assault and violence within the realm of ridesharing, emphasizing the importance of being aware, precautionary measures, and the role of law enforcement in combating these issues.
Recognizing the Extent and Consequences:
Sexual assault and violence in ridesharing vehicles are deeply distressing crimes that have serious consequences for survivors and the community at large. Data indicate that these incidents take place more often than we would like to acknowledge. Survivors endure physical and emotional trauma, while those who witness or experience such incidents also suffer from the psychological effects. Dealing with these risks requires a thorough understanding of the root causes contributing to these offenses.
Identifying Factors that Increase Vulnerability:
Several risk factors add to the susceptibility of both drivers and passengers in ridesharing vehicles. The unique nature of the platform, uber rape which often involves strangers in close proximity, heightens the likelihood for dangerous situations. Factors such as late-night rides, passengers under the influence, lack of adequate background checks, and the absence of in-vehicle security features can further exacerbate the risks. It is essential to recognize these elements and take proactive measures to mitigate them.
Improved Safety Measures:
Rideshare companies have a responsibility to ensure the security of their users. They should regularly review and enhance safety measures to combat sexual assault and violence. Some key precautionary steps include:
a) Rigorous background checks: Comprehensive background checks should be conducted on those providing the rides to uncover any previous records or behavioral issues.
b) Driver and passenger verification: Employing robust methods, such as verifying users' identities through verification or unique biometrics, can help lower the likelihood of unauthorized access to the platform.
c) In-app safety features: Both leading rideshare providers have implemented security measures, such as panic buttons, live location tracking, and two-way ratings, to ensure accountability and enable swift responses to potential emergencies.
d) Education and training: Providing thorough training programs to drivers and passengers, covering awareness of potential risks, conflict de-escalation, and how to report incidents, is vital. Promoting a climate of zero tolerance for assault and violence within the ridesharing environment is critical.
Active Law Enforcement Involvement:
Law enforcement agencies play a critical role in addressing sexual assault and violence within the ridesharing sector. They should collaborate closely with ridesharing companies to develop effective approaches to tackle and respond to such crimes. Some key steps for law enforcement authorities include:
a) Enhanced reporting mechanisms: Establishing efficient reporting channels and ensuring confidentiality for victims can promote more reporting and facilitate enforcement efforts.
b) Partnerships and information exchange: Collaborating and exchanging information between police and ridesharing companies can assist in identifying repeat offenders and strengthening preemptive measures.
c) Workshops and educational programs: Conducting training sessions for law enforcement personnel to gain insight into the specificities of sexual assault and violence in the ridesharing sector can enhance their capacity to respond effectively.
Tackling the risks of sexual assault and violence in the ridesharing industry is a complex issue that demands collective efforts. By acknowledging the prevalence of these incidents, implementing thorough security protocols, and fostering active involvement from police authorities and the society, we can strive towards a safer future for ride-hailing. It is essential to create an atmosphere where drivers and passengers can utilize these services without concerns or anxieties.
